Tanya Anderssen tracks down Warren Worthington III with a shocking revelation: her lost love, Karl Lykos, is alive in the Savage Land. With Jameson demanding a scoop, Peter Parker joins the expedition, unaware of the danger awaiting them. Once in the jungle, Spider-Man and Angel are captured by the Mutates and brought before the enigmatic Brainchild.

In "To Sacrifice My Soul...", Spider-Man and Angel are horrifically transformed by Brainchild and sent to clash with Ka-Zar and the Fall People in the heart of the Savage Land. When Tanya Anderssen is captured and subjected to the same fate, the desperate attempt to reverse the mutation unleashes a shocking transformation that leaves Sauron in control—leaving Spider-Man and Angel to flee with the fate of the land hanging in the balance.

In "Into the Land of Death...", the X-Men plunge into the perilous Savage Land in a desperate hunt for Sauron, only to be overwhelmed by the Mutates. Trapped and scattered, the team is broken apart—only Angel remains free as the others are taken to face Sauron and Zaladane in a deadly confrontation.

In "Lost Souls," with the X-Men imprisoned by Sauron, Angel teams up with Ka-Zar in a desperate bid to free them, venturing deep into the Savage Land’s perilous heart. As the rescue unfolds, the fate of Sauron—once Karl Lykos—hangs in the balance, even as Xavier believes his cure has finally broken the villain’s hold.
